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Woodland Park Apartments

How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Woodland Park Apartment?

The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Woodland Park is $1,390.

What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Woodland Park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Woodland Park is a 905 square feet unit starting from $925 at The Annex.

What is the average size for Woodland Park 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?

The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Woodland Park is currently 703 sq ft.
